释义 | theosophicallyadv. a. In a theosophical manner; by means of theosophy. ΘΚΠ society > faith > aspects of faith > doctrine > doctrine concerning God or a god > [adverb] > theosophically theosophically1689 1689 Tryon (title) A Treatise of Dreams and Visions, wherein The Causes Natures and Uses of Nocturnal Representations, and the Communications both of Good and Evil Angels, as also departed Souls, to Mankinde, Are Theosophically Unfolded. 1855 E. Smedley et al. Occult Sci. 135 The doctrine of Bœhmen,..worked out theosophically. b. By means of or in accordance with theosophy (in sense 2). ΘΚΠ the world > the supernatural > the occult > [adverb] > by means of theosophy theosophically1896 1896 Columbus (Ohio) Dispatch 21 July 4/3 C. B...says: Theosophically I know that W. J. Bryan is the reincarnation of Andrew Jackson, and spiritually I see around him the forms of Washington, Lincoln and the lamented Polk.
